sql server
自渡,难渡。
思,事而为师者。
展开
-
SQL 查询更新插入规范
简要说明:本篇主讲 查询(select)和更新(update)的规范,略微捎带 插入(insert)的规范。可能有人会问为什么不规范delete。首先 delete 本就不应该出现在生成代码上,delete 权限的开放意味着,如果开发人员如果编写了delete ,一但筛选不够准确,会导致数据丢失的严重事故。前提背景:由于业务前期的不规范性,导致了开发/测试的表结构版本于生产不一致(此不一致不包含新开发内容),后续在不影响开发测试流程尽可能会将表结构于生产调整至一致。OLTP 与 OLA.原创 2020-09-28 11:50:04 · 343 阅读 · 0 评论 -
ApexSQLLog :SqlServer 数据恢复 AND ApexSQLLog使用图解
一、对数据库进行登录二、对数据进行筛选选择结果数据展示5. 最后结果,和数据恢复软件下载:ApexSQLLog_SqlServer数据恢复原创 2019-08-13 16:56:59 · 6340 阅读 · 6 评论 -
sql server 中实现:根据排序字段进行排序,条件:大于等于1进行升序,小于1的进行降序
最终效果:代码:实现了效果SELECT Sort FROM 表名 ORDER BY CASE WHEN Sort >= 1 THEN 0 ELSE 1 END, Sort ASC代码二:加上了分页代码SELECT ROW_NUMBER() OVER ( ORDER ...原创 2019-07-04 17:54:42 · 3653 阅读 · 0 评论 -
简单还原sqlserver数据库
第一步,我们选择数据库,点击右键——》点击还原文件和文件组第二步,还原目标可选择你要还原的数据库,也可以新建数据库,然后我们选择原设备,点击(...)第三步,选择备份设备,点击添加,找到你备份的文件,然后确定。第四步,选择还原选择框,然后确定。注:数据库操作,细心,细心,再细心。数据无价,丢失不再!!!...原创 2019-03-26 10:40:51 · 637 阅读 · 0 评论 -
nacicat premium 还原sqlserver数据库 mdf/ldf
一、首先我们把需要处理的 数据文件找到, 二、然后找到nacicat premium 的系统存放文件,我的是在D盘。把刚才的文件复制过去 三、我在nacicat premium 新建一个查询,写入生气了,找到系统路径。然后运行...原创 2018-10-23 10:23:40 · 1153 阅读 · 0 评论 -
mysql:1103 错误解决方案
问题:Host *.*.*.* is not allowed to connect to解决方案:use mysql;update user set host = '%' where user = 'root';select host, user from user; 在mysql 控制台运行原创 2017-12-19 10:00:14 · 18646 阅读 · 0 评论 -
同服务器数据库之间的数据操作与不同服务器数据库之间的数据操作
注:并非本人原创,网络搜索整理结果/*同服务器数据库之间的数据操作*/--将一个表的数据复制到另外数据库的表中--目的表不存在 select * into [库名].表名 from [库名(需要复制的)].表名例如:select * into B.dbo.table from A.dbo.table--目的表已经存在insert转载 2017-09-26 17:40:19 · 614 阅读 · 0 评论 -
关系型数据库和非关系型数据库
关系型数据库和非关系型数据库关系数据库和非关系数据库的区别是,关系数据库只有“表”这一种数据结构;而非关系数据库系统还有其他数据结构,对这些数据结构还有其他操作。随着网络的不断发展,单纯关系数据库面临挑战。关系与非关系型数据库的特点1.关系型数据库关系型数据库,是指采用了关系模型来组织数据的数据库。简单来说,关系模型指的就是二维表格模型,而一个关系型数据库就转载 2017-08-29 11:04:29 · 475 阅读 · 0 评论 -
mssql单个用户与多个用户
数据库变成单个用户访问权限改为多用户USE master; GO DECLARE @SQL VARCHAR(MAX); SET @SQL='' SELECT @SQL=@SQL+'; KILL '+RTRIM(SPID) FROM master..sysprocesses WHERE dbid=DB_ID('数据库名称'); EXEC(原创 2017-05-05 17:44:18 · 791 阅读 · 0 评论